WEB SERVICE que retorne ESTADOS E CIDADES

Alguém conhece algum web service que retorne todas as cidades e estados do brasil?

Eu quero para utilizar dessa maneira:

Uma opção pro usuário escolher o Estado
Assim que o usuário escolher o Estado ele irá escolher as Cidades em outra opção(obvio né) deste Estado

Se alguém poder me ajudar fico grato

Estou desenvolvendo em Xamarin Forms

Procurando no google, achei essa resposta aqui: https://pt.stackoverflow.com/questions/76640/existe-alguma-api-que-liste-estados-e-cidades

Que no caso indica esse web service aqui:
http://www.geonames.org/childrenJSON?geonameId=3469034
http://www.geonames.org/childrenJSON?geonameId=3665474

Parece bem simples de usar. Nao sei o quao confiável é isso, mas enfim, é uma alternativa.

A pergunta que eu faria para você é: tem certeza que quer fazer usuário escolher a cidade assim? Um estado pode ter dezenas de cidades. Usar uma combobox com esse número de elementos num celular é uma experiência terrível.

1 curtida

That’s the best one I’ve found. They let you download and host the web service yourself, which is also nice.